TypeName.GetGenericTypeDefinition Method

Definition

Returns a TypeName object that represents a generic type name definition from which the current generic type name can be constructed.

public:
 System::Reflection::Metadata::TypeName ^ GetGenericTypeDefinition();
public System.Reflection.Metadata.TypeName GetGenericTypeDefinition ();
member this.GetGenericTypeDefinition : unit -> System.Reflection.Metadata.TypeName
Public Function GetGenericTypeDefinition () As TypeName

Returns

Exceptions

The current type is not a generic type.

Remarks

Given "Dictionary<string, int>", this method returns the generic type definition "Dictionary<,>".

Applies to